Changes to Covid-19 guidance

NHS Scotland have recently issued a letter to healthcare professionals.

The letter outlines the process for the transition from the Winter Respiratory IPC Addendum Covid-19 guidance back to the National Infection Prevention and Control Manual (NIPCM).

The letter explains what the next stages for managing Covid within a health and care setting will look like. This includes advice that all non-patient facing healthcare workers should cease routine workplace asymptomatic testing. Patient facing staff must continue to take lateral flow tests twice weekly due to working in a higher risk setting.

The transition will be supported by an infographic and an accompanying document detailing specific updates to each of the chapters of the NIPCM with relevant hyperlinks where required. The expected implementation date is Monday 11 July, at which point the Winter Respiratory IPC addendum will be removed from the website.
